Columbia Tristar has now updated the Hellboy DVD website from the normal edition to the DC edition. Here are the official final specs:

DVD Features

Disc One:

* All-new Commentary by Guillermo del Toro, Exclusively for the Director's Cut
* Video Introduction by Guillermo del Toro
* Creator Audio Commentary: Guillermo del Toro (Director) and Mike Mignola (Co-ExecutiveProducer)
* Cast Audio Commentary: Ron Perlman, Selma Blair, Jeffrey Tambor and Rupert Evans
* Branching DVD Comics drawn by Mike Mignola
* "Right Hand of Doom" Set Visits
* Storyboard Track
* "From the Den" Hellboy recommends... Gerald McBoing Boing animated shorts
* DVD-ROM: Printable Original Screenplay Script, Supervisor's Book, Director's Notebook

Disc Two:

* Video Introduction by Selma Blair
* "Hellboy: The Seeds of Creation" A 2 1/2 hour documentary on the making of the film. Includes The Origin of the Comic, Prosthetic Effects, Visual Effects, Set Design, Stunts and more!
* Deleted Scenes with optional commentary by Guillermo del Toro
* Character Bios written by the Director
* Motion Board-a-matics
* Animatics
* Multi-Angle Storyboard Comparisons
* Maquette 3-D Character Sculptures Video Gallery
* Poster Explorations
* Trailers and TV Spots
* Weblink to Hellboy Merchandise
* Filmographies

Disc Three:

* Video Introduction by Ron Perlman
* Video Commentary with Ron Perlman, Selma Blair, Jeffrey Tambor and Rupert Evans
* Production Workshops with Commentary by Guillermo del Toro
* Q&A Archive: Comic Com 2002
* Scott McCloud: A Quick Guide to Understanding Comics
* Interactive Director's Notebook
* Photo Gallery
* Mike Mignola Artwork Photo Montage
* Widescreen Presentation
* Languages: English, French 5.1 (Dolby Digital)
* Subtitles: English, French
* Mastered in High Definition
* Over 13 minutes of recut and extended footage
* Includes Exclusive Collectible: Excerpt From the Diary of Grigori Rasputin, created by Mike Mignola
